How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Cambridge?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
North Cambridge Studio Apartments | $2,736 | $1,800 | $6,507 |
North Cambrid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,176 | $1,155 | $10,000+ |
North Cambrid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,668 | $2,200 | $10,000+ |
North Cambrid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,223 | $1,025 | $10,000+ |
North Cambridge 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,871 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
North Cambridge 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,651 | $875 | $10,000+ |
North Cambridge 6 Bedroom Apartments | $7,118 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ly North Cambridge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in North Cambridge?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in North Cambridge is at 65 Adams St, Unit 2 listed at $1,500.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ly North Cambridge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in North Cambridge is $4,264.
What is the largest Pet Friendly North Cambridge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in North Cambridge is a 10,000 square feet unit starting from $4,050 at 26 White St, Unit 1.
What is the average size for North Cambridge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in North Cambridge is currently at 3,681 sq ft.
